Output 28362ea1cfacc155f12235518a22af9a71a7dbcd5d7f3e683c26c3e3473e8344:0

value
14704200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 523b676bfef84332b929c8ffba50bcbe3f7c2630 OP_EQUAL
address
39BpVjcdbt3LSqnMvreSthjZCbSVonb2qE
transaction
28362ea1cfacc155f12235518a22af9a71a7dbcd5d7f3e683c26c3e3473e8344
confirmations
283217
spent
true